#0affec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0affec is composed of 3.9% red, 100%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 175.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 52%. #0affec color hex could be obtained by blending #14ffff with #00ffd9. Closest websafe color is: #00ffff.

Shades and Tints of #0affec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a09 is the darkest color, while #f5fffe is the lightest one.
